From the final report:
"Rider 2 (son) rode over to the buried sled and saw Rider 1’s (father) boot in the snow. He started digging. Rider 1 was buried face-down, with his head under about one foot of avalanche debris. His torso was wedged between the track and tunnel, perpendicular to the sled. The avalanche or impact of the snowmobile broke the lake ice and Rider 1 was pinned in a slushy mix of avalanche debris and water. Rider 2 was unable to free his father from the snowmobile, and used the shovel to prop his head out of the water.
